The film substitutes the mythical forests of Indian folklore with the historical canyons of Jordan. However, the challenges Bheem faces are not historically grounded (e.g., trade routes, Roman conquests) but universal fairytale trials: collapsing bridges, coded riddles, and a final magical duel. This structural replication ensures that even as the setting becomes foreign, the moral universe remains staunchly Dholakpuri. The “journey” is geographically outward but ideologically circular; Bheem learns nothing new about other cultures, only reaffirming his own strength and cleverness.
